فایلار
Generic selectors
Exact matches only
Search in title
Search in content
Search in posts
Search in pages
اطلاعات بیشتر

پاورپوینت لایه کاربرد در شبکه Application Layer

پاورپوینت لایه کاربرد در شبکه Application Layer

دسته بندیکامپیوتر و IT
فرمت فایلppt
حجم فایل۲٫۲۰۱ مگا بایت
تعداد صفحات۳۶
برای دانلود فایل روی دکمه زیر کلیک کنید
دریافت فایل

نوع فایل: پاورپوینت (قابل ویرایش)

قسمتی از متن پاورپوینت :

تعداد اسلاید : ۳۶ صفحه

لایه کاربرد در شبکه
Application Layer 3 لایه کاربرد قرار دادهای دیگری لازم است تا کاربران بتوانند از خدمات شبکه استفاده کنند:
قرارداد سیستم ترجمه نام (DNS)
HTTP (Hyper Text Transfer Protocol)
FTP (File Transfer Protocol)
Email (SMTP IMAP POP3)
Telnet
SNMP (Simple Network Management Protocol)
امنیت شبکه ۴ DNS (Domain Name System) کامپیوترها در اینترنت با آدرس IP شناسایی می شوند.

هر فایل در اینترنت با یک URL شناسایی می شود.

کار با URL های رشته ای راحت تر است:

DNS: سرویس تبدیل نام به آدرس در شبکه است. ۵ در ابتدا این کار از طریق فایل Hosts.txt انجام می شد.

در اینترنت از یک مدل درختی استفاده می شود.

در سطح بالای درخت انواع دسته های ممکن وجود دارد:
Com net Org ac edu jp ir ca uk … DNS (Domain Name System) URLs – Uniform Resource Locaters 6 The DNS Name Space 7 8 DNS…How to Work? مثال www. yahoo .com :
میزبان ابتدا آدرس را از سرور نام محلی خود می پرسد. اگر جواب گرفت که کار پایان می یابد.
سرور نام محلی از سرویس دهنده ریشه در خواست آدرس سرور نام .com را می کند.
از سرور نام .comآدرس سرور نام yahoo .com در خواست می شود.
در سرور نام yahoo .com آدرس www. yahoo .com در خواست می شود. ۹ How a resolver looks up a remote name in eight steps. 10 HTTP (Hyper Text Transfer Protocol) پر استفاده ترین سرویس شبکه و اینترنت است.

دارای معماری Client/Server است.

مبتنی بر پروتکل TCP است.

هر صفحه وب متشکل از متن، تصویر و لینک و… است. ۱۱ به طرف سرور، Web Server می گویند که دارای تعدادی صفحه وب بر روی خود است.

IISو Apacheنمونه هایی از Web Serverهای پرکاربرد امروزی هستند.

HTTP: پروتکلی که نحوه مبادله درخواست صفحه ها بین مشتری و سرویس دهنده را توصیف می کند. HTTP (Hyper Text Transfer Protocol) 12 مراحلی که پس از انتخاب یک HYPER LINK توسط clientانجام می شوند مرورگر URL را تعیین می کند.
مرورگر با استفاده از DNS آدرس IP قسمت دامنه (Domain) را استخراج می کند.
DNS آدرس IP را بر میگرداند.(مثلا ۱۶۴٫۱۸٫۱۶۸٫۲۵)
مرورگر با پورت ۸۰ کامپیوتر آدرس IP فوق ارتباط TCPبرقرار می کند.
سپس فایل /home/index.htmlدرخواست می شود(فرمان GET ).
سرور فایل html مورد نظر را ارسال می کند.
مرورگر فایل را نمایش می دهد. ۱۳ برخی فرمانهای HTTP 14 پذیرش اتصال TCP از مشتری)مرورگر)

دریافت نام فایل برای جستجو

گرفتن فایل از دیسک

برگرداندن فایل به مشتری

قطع اتصالTCP

استفاده از متدهای caching برای حداقل کردن مراجعه به دیسک
مراحلی که توسط Web Serverانجام می شوند Architecture Overview 15 16 HTTP… HTML: زبان مورد استفاده برای ایجاد صفحات وب ایستا.

مرورگر(Browser): نرم افزاری که کدهای HTML را دریافت و آنرا تبدیل به صفحات وب می کند:
Internet explorer Fire Fox Mozilla Opera …

صفحات وب می توانند به صورت پویا باشند. ۱۷ در وب پویا کاربر با سرور وب محاوره می کند.

ابزارهای برنامه نویسی وب پویا:
CGI ASP PHP JSP … java script vb script …

XHTMLو XSLو XMLابزارهای توسعه یافته HTML اولیه هستند.

XML به محتوای صفحات وب می پردازد و XSL مخصوص طراحی قالب (نمایش) است


توجه: متن بالا فقط قسمت کوچکی از محتوای فایل پاورپوینت بوده و بدون ظاهر گرافیکی می باشد و پس از دانلود، فایل کامل آنرا با تمامی اسلایدهای آن دریافت می کنید.

رایگان اطلاعات بیشتر
سبد آیتم حذف شد برگرداندن محصول حذف شده
  • سبد خالی از محصول می باشد.